Frequently Asked Questions

What should I bring to my first appointment?

Bring a valid photo ID, your insurance card, a list of current medications including supplements, and any relevant medical records or test results from previous providers. Arriving a few minutes early allows time to complete any required paperwork.

Does the practice offer telehealth appointments?

Telehealth visits are available for established patients with conditions suitable for remote evaluation. Common telehealth uses include medication refills, minor illness follow-up, and results review. Your provider can advise whether an in-person visit is necessary.

How often should I schedule a primary care visit?

Most adults benefit from an annual wellness visit even when feeling healthy. Patients managing chronic conditions such as hypertension or diabetes typically need more frequent check-ins, usually every three to six months depending on how well the condition is controlled.
